Abstract:An improved incoherent back projection (BP) imaging method is proposed, in which self-amplitude weighting is applied to improve the resolution of each coarse image and multiplicative tomography weighting is applied to suppress the background interference as well as to further enhance the final image resolution. Performance of this method is investigated through numerical simulation and experiment. The results show that, compared with traditional BP imaging method, the proposed method achieves remarkably improved resolution and background suppression. Therefore, this improved BP imaging method is a good solution to high-performance radar imaging. © 2019 IEEE.
